Nike and Adidas mandate clothing at Olympics

Sagemind says...

The rule is one of several strict guidelines set by organisers to protect the exclusivity rights of sponsors such as Coca-Cola, Visa and McDonald’s and prevents ambush stunts from rival non-sponsors. It means that athletes are prevented from endorsing their individual sponsors throughout the event.

Athletes found in breach of the laws could be fined and disqualified from the Games, although this has never happened.

Coke in the new bottle bag - Is this a good thing?

Coke in the new bottle bag - Is this a good thing?

grinter says...

@wormwood. I don't for one second think that Coca Cola is doing this for environmental reasons, but plastic bottles were never an issue. Coca Cola is, and has been, selling their product in reusable glass bottles. Customers don't want to pay the deposit on the glass bottle (or bother bringing the bottle back), and that's where plastic enters the picture.
